Cala el Golfet is a cove in the municipality of Palafrugell, on the Costa Brava (Catalonia, Spain). DiverMar shows in real time whether it's a good moment to swim, snorkel or go out on a kayak or paddle board: official lifeguard flag, waves, wind, water temperature, UV index, visibility and jellyfish warnings, with an hourly forecast until sunset.
